THIRTY-TWO-YEAR-OLD Clive Nero of Lot 251 Blue Saki Drive, South Ruimveldt, Georgetown, appeared yesterday before Chief Magistrate Priya Sewnarine-Beharry on an embezzlement charge that alleged that between August 26, 2013 and July 2, 2014 at Tiger Creek, Cuyuni River, being employed as a clerk or servant by Lakeram Singh, he embezzled the sum of $1.58M.Represented by Attorney-at-law Adrian Thompson, Nero denied the allegation, claiming a mixed-up situation at a call centre was responsible for the money not being accounted for.
Thompson said his client had made arrangements with the virtual complainant (VC) to repay the sum of money in a given time, but was unable to do so; hence the VC reported the matter to the police, and Nero was placed on station bail.
Nero was ordered to post $250,000 bail, and will have to report to the F Division police every fortnight, commencing this Friday.
The defendant was also slapped with a charge, detailing that on April 13 at Tiger Creek, he unlawfully assaulted Erick Gordon so as to cause him actual bodily harm. He was placed on his own recognizance after pleading not guilty to this charge, and the matters were transferred to the Bartica Court for report and fixtures on July 24.
